Anyone have any experience with these fish in your reef tank?
Im reading they can be reef safe with caution. Looking to hear personal experiences now, please.. :biggrin:



http://www.muiscontrols.com/ryan/p_76385.jpg
Yellow Coris Wrasse (Halichoeres chrysus)


http://www.muiscontrols.com/ryan/p_80424.jpg
Yellow & Purple Wrasse (Halichoeres trispilus)

Had the yellow wrasse in my 42g when it was set up. Didn't bother corals and got along with everyone else, but I'm sure it picked at the rock quite a bit. Some people find wrasses of most species a little aggressive. Mine didn't seem to be, but then, I added most of my fish around the same time.

Doug
05-12-2005, 08:47 PM
The yellows seem to be good residents. Like to sleep in the sand, pretty good for flatworms, but also compete with mandarins and the such, for pods.

Bad jumpers in a smaller tank.

I have had a Yellow Coris Wrasse (Halichoeres chrysus) in my tank for 8 months now and it get's along with everything including all inverts. My 6 line wrasse likes to chase it around a bit but the yellow wrasse is no problem so far.
